As a kid, I would get chronic ear infections all the time. It got to the point where I had a surgery where they put tubes in my ears and had a Adenoidectomy due to I believe an enlarged adenoid (I was snoring even when my mouth was closed). Ever since that surgery I have had ear problems. Every time I yawn, chew, or swallow, my ears pop. It’s really annoying, everything gets weirdly loud but muffled, I sound different, and I’m able to hear my heartbeat. In order to alleviate this, I have to sniffle hard enough to pop my ears back to normal. Every time I’m sick one of my ears gets clogged up with fluid and it can be so hard to hear out of that ear. I had this surgery when I was around 8 years old and I am now 20. I have been dealing with this for over a decade now, I’m very self conscious about my sniffling and I’m so worried people think my sniffling is annoying. I have talked to my doctor about it where she prescribed Flonase, but it did absolutely nothing for me. I’m curious if this is even ETB, or if this is something entirely different? I’ve also noticed my balance isn’t great (I could never ice skate or roller skate for the life of me, surfing was also a no-go). Whatever I have has caused me a lot of distress, and I wish it could go away, but I’m afraid this might be permanent.
